Pat Autenrieth is a mixed media artist working in Hyattsville, MD, using photography, digital printing, silkscreen, rubbings, rubber stamps, drawing, painting, collage, embroidery, appliqué, photo dye and quilting. Ms. Autenrieth studied the art of sewing before it was considered a legitimate art medium, but thanks to the feminist movement and the rise of material culture studies, making quilts has gained greater recognition in the art world.
